One of the out-patient treatment options for clients in Greenwood who are struggling with opioid dependence and addiction is opioid maintenance therapy. Licensed clinics and doctors are certified to administer certain meds to opioid addicted individuals, many of which are opioid-based also and are addictive. With low doses the individual doesn't experience high feelings and also does not have acute cravings and is not experiencing opioid withdrawal. Methadone is the first drug tried for this sole purpose, but there are other choices to select from.

Methadone is an opioid and can be taken at an outpatient clinic licensed to administer the drug, that is taken daily as a pill or liquid. The price of the drug is about $150 per month. Buprenorphine is also an opiate based med, and is in pill form often taken every other day. But different from Methadone that is only be given in structured clinics, Buprenorphine can be prescribed and dispensed in doctor's offices. The monthly cost of buprenorphine is around $300 monthly for the generic of the med. There is also a type of buprenorphine that contains naloxone, which is a drug which blocks the effects of opioids. A person consuming this formulation, also known as Suboxone, would find it harder to feel high from opioids if they relapsed while taking the drug. It is also taken daily, and is priced approximately $450 a month. Naltrexone is another med taken in opioid maintenance therapy, but unlike the other medications aforementioned it's an opiate blocker and isn't an opioid. There is an option to take this medication as a monthly injection, which is called Vivitrol. As an opioid blocker, it prevents an individual from experience high feelings from opioids, and in turn lowers the risk associated with relapse. This daily injection costs in the range of $1000 to $1200 monthly.
